What companies run services between Hemel Hempstead, England and Leamington Spa Station, England?

You can take a train from Hemel Hempstead to Leamington Spa via Milton Keynes Central and Coventry in around 1h 50m. Alternatively, National Express operates a bus from Luton Station Interchange to Pool Meadow Bus Station hourly. Tickets cost £14–35 and the journey takes 2h 30m.
